What Is An Eraser Made From. Eraser, piece of rubber or other material used to rub out marks made by ink, pencil, or chalk. Erasers can be made of various materials, depending on the intended use. The primary ingredients include rubber, sulfur, vegetable oil, and pumice. An eraser is typically made up of several ingredients. The mixture is processed and extruded and, if made.
